Abstract:
An active distance measuring apparatus with the remote control function is provided with a plurality of light projecting portions, a plurality of light receiving portions, a distance measuring device for effecting active distance measurement at one or more points in an image field by the use of all or some of the plurality of light projecting portions and the plurality of light receiving portions, and a remote control for performing, when the light receiving portions receive signal light from a remote control transmitter, a predetermined remote control operation by the use of the output of the light receiving portion which has received the signal light, the distance measuring device distance-measuring a distance measuring point corresponding to the light receiving portion which has received the signal light from the remote control transmitter. By the light receiving portions for active distance measurement being used also as the light receiving portions of the remote control device, there can always be taken photographs which are accurately in focus to the remote control operator.
Abstract:
A distance-measuring apparatus comprises a light emitting device for emitting a beam toward a plurality of portions in a field, a light receiving device for receiving a reflection beam from an object located at each of the plurality of portions and outputting a receiving signal according thereto, a selecting device for searching out a region where the receiving signal exceeds a predetermined value out of the plurality of portions and selecting an aimed portion for distance measurement from the searched-out region where the receiving signal exceeds the predetermined value, and a measuring device for measuring an object distance based on a receiving signal from the aimed portion for distance measurement.
Abstract:
An automatic film rewinding apparatus, for use in a camera, is provided with a stopping device for interrupting an automatic film rewinding operation while such rewinding operation is conducted by the automatic film rewinding apparatus, and an operation unit for activating the stopping device, wherein the automatic film rewinding is interrupted by the stopping device only during the operation of the operation unit, but is re-started after the termination of operation of the operation unit.

Abstract:
A display device has a display having a scale plate and an indicator movable on the scale plate, an instruction unit for releasing an instruction signal for moving the indicator, and a drive unit for moving the indicator based on the instruction signal. The device also has a detector for detecting whether the indicator is in movement or not. When the detector detects that the indicator is in movement, the movement of the indicator by another new instruction signal, eventually released from the instruction unit, is inhibited. Such movement of the indicator by another new instruction signal is permitted only when the detector detects that the indicator is not in movement.
Abstract:
An encoder for generating a position signal in accordance with a position of a conductive slider comprises a non-conductive substrate, a first conductive pattern formed on the substrate, and at least three second conductive patterns formed on the substrate. The second patterns are independent from the first pattern. Each of the second patterns has a lead wire extending to an edge of the substrate. The slider is slidable on the substrate, and produces a conductive state signal when it abuts against the first pattern and produces a non-conductive state signal when it abuts against the second pattern or the substrate. The position signal is generated in accordance with the conductive state signal and the non-conductive state signal. One of the second patterns is surrounded by the first pattern, and the lead wire extending therefrom passes between the other two second patterns and extends to the exterior of the first pattern.
Abstract:
An automatic focusing camera comprises a measuring device formed integrally with a camera housing, defining a distance measuring zone selectively extended in different directions, and adapted for producing information employed for focusing to an object contained in the extended distance measuring zone. A position detecting device for detecting the position of the camera housing, and a device for varying the extending direction of the distance measuring zone, in response to the position of the camera housing detected by the position detecting device.
